How to fill out the Tdjcprogram Proposal Form online

This guide provides clear and detailed instructions on how to complete the Tdjcprogram Proposal Form online. By following these steps, users will be able to appropriately fill out the form and submit their proposals effectively.

Follow the steps to fill out the Tdjcprogram Proposal Form online

  1. Click the ‘Get Form’ button to access the Tdjcprogram Proposal Form and open it for editing.
  2. Begin by filling in your job title, agency name, and your name in the format of Last, First, Middle. This information identifies you as the facilitator of the proposed program.
  3. Input the last four numbers of your driver's license, your office telephone number, and your address, including city, state, and zip code, so the Texas Department of Criminal Justice can contact you.
  4. Provide your web address, email address, and fax number. These will serve as your contact methods.
  5. Select the type of program you are proposing by checking the appropriate box. Options include literacy/education, employment/job skills, medical issues/prevention, arts/crafts, victim awareness, support groups, and others.
  6. Enter the name of your activity or program and indicate the geographic preference or facility name where the program will be implemented.
  7. Specify your scheduling preferences, including preferred duration, length, cycle, and target time schedule. Include any necessary explanations in the provided sections.
  8. Describe the target population you intend to serve and specify any selection criteria for offenders if applicable.
  9. Detail the activity/program components, including goals, objectives, intended benefits to offenders, and evaluation methods or outcome measures. Attach additional pages if needed.
  10. If your proposal includes curriculums, workbooks, or handouts, ensure to attach those items with the submission.
  11. Once you have completed all sections, review your entries for accuracy. You can then save your changes, download the form, print it, or share it via email.

G4 - Faith Based Row, Most Innovative Program G4 offenders are classified as medium custody because of behavioral problems, and as a result, live with certain restrictions. A G4 offender wrote "If you can't act right in society, you go to prison. If you can't act right in prison, you go to medium custody."

The IPTC is an intensive, six-month treatment program for incarcerated offenders who are within six months of parole release who are identified as needing substance abuse treatment. Offenders must be chemically dependent as shown by an accepted substance abuse screening instrument.

Regional release sites are located at the Clements Unit (Amarillo), Crain Unit (Gatesville), Huntsville Unit (Huntsville), Hutchins State Jail (Dallas), McConnell Unit (Beeville), and Robertson Unit (Abilene).
